The R&S®ZNA vector network analyzers represent the premium series in the portfolio, combining a unique hardware concept, an extensive range of software features, and exceptional RF performance. With its touch-only functionality and DUT-centric methodology, the R&S®ZNA is a powerful, universal, and compact measurement tool for both passive and active device characterization.
| Key Performance | Details |
|---|---|
| Dynamic range | > 129 dB (specification, without options), 147 dB (typ., with options), up to 170 dB (maximum attainable range, allowing full 2-port correction) |
| Sensitivity | > -120 dBm (1 Hz IF bandwidth) (spec., without options), -162 dBm (1 Hz IF bandwidth) (meas., with options)¹ |
| Power sweep range | 100 dB (typ.), continuous electronic sweep range, can be shifted using mechanical step-attenuators |
| Source power linearity | 0.2 dB (typ., from -40 dBm to +10 dBm) |
| Receiver compression | 0.05 dB (typ., up to +8 dBm with reference to -10 dBm, at test port) |
| Trace noise | 0.005 dB (spec., RMS), 0.002 dB (typ., RMS) (10 GHz, 100 kHz measurement bandwidth, 0 dB reflection) |
| Speed | 10 MHz to 43.5 GHz, 500 kHz measurement bandwidth, 1601 points, 2-port calibration, sweep time: 96 ms (nom.) |
| Jitter Spectrum Analysis (JSA)¹ | Yes |

The R&S®ZNA offers a standard dynamic range of > 129 dB without options. With options enabled, it can achieve 147 dB typical and up to 170 dB maximum attainable range, allowing for comprehensive 2-port correction.
The R&S®ZNA67EXT vector network analyzer system supports a broad frequency measurement range from 10 MHz to 110 GHz.
Yes, the system can contain up to four internal phase-coherent sources, which yields high flexibility and helps enable short sweep durations during measurement cycles.
The instrument standard size matches 6 Rack Units (EIA RU) with dimensions of 461.4 mm × 284.6 mm × 462.1 mm. The 2-port models weigh 24 kg, while the 4-port configurations weigh 29 kg.
It features highly stable raw data with trace noise specified at 0.005 dB RMS (0.002 dB RMS typical) measured at 10 GHz with a 100 kHz measurement bandwidth and 0 dB reflection.
